How to run a full system check on PC?
A full PC checkup involves evaluating your computers hardware, software, and security to ensure everything runs smoothly. Start by running Windows native diagnostic tool: press Win + R, type perfmon /report, and hit Enter to get a comprehensive health report in 60 seconds.
Hardware and Performance Diagnostics
To fully evaluate your computers health and performance, you need to check both your storage drives and memory modules. Storage health is critical because failing drives can corrupt your files without warning. Open Command Prompt as administrator and run chkdsk c: /f /r to scan and repair hard drive errors. For your RAM, use the free MemTest86 software on a USB drive to boot up and ensure your memory is free of errors. For system and storage management, download Microsoft PC Manager from the official Microsoft Store to run quick health checks, free up disk space, and manage startup processes.
Security, Updates, and System Requirements
Performance is only half the battle; security and software compatibility dictate how safely your system operates. Run a full malware scan using Windows Defender or a third-party app like Malwarebytes to catch hidden threats. Make sure you are running the latest software and that your device passes Windows 11 Specifications and Requirements using the built-in PC health check guide. This ensures your hardware supports modern security features and will continue receiving critical updates.

How often should I run a full system check on my PC?
Running a comprehensive system health check every one to three months helps catch minor software glitches and storage errors before they turn into major hardware failures.
Will running system diagnostic commands delete my files?
No, standard diagnostic utilities like performance monitors and check disk commands analyze or repair existing files without deleting your personal documents or applications.
Do I need paid antivirus software to keep my PC secure?
Built-in security tools like Windows Defender provide robust, real-time protection for most users, making third-party paid software optional unless you require specialized enterprise features.
